Dumping a list of internal sounds

Instrument list dump

Instrument list dump request (request only) [Pro]

This command requests a bulk dump of a list of the preset sounds (Instruments) in internal memory, and uses "Data Request 1 (RQ1)" format. The Size specifies the contents of the requested data.

Address:

0C 00 01

Size:

00 00 00

: ALL

 

00 00 01

: SC-55 MAP

 

00 00 02

: SC-88 MAP

 

00 00 03

: Native MAP

00 mm bb mm = MAP# 01 - 03 ( 01 = SC-55 MAP, 02 = SC-88 MAP, 03 = Native MAP)

bb= BANK# 00 - 7F

Instrument list dump (transmit only) [Pro]

When Instrument List Dump Request is received, the sound names of the specified map will be transmitted continuously in the format given below, where 16 bytes are used for each sound name. The Address of the transmitted data is 0C 00 01 for all packets.User bank sound names are not transmitted.

DUMP FORMAT:

0 1

2

3 4

5 6 7 8 9 A B C D E F

 

CC0

MAP

PC

00

 

TONE NAME(ASCII 12 Characters)

 

 

 

 

 

 

 

 

 

CC0 : Variation number

MAP : MAP number 01 = SC-55 MAP, 02 = SC-88 MAP, 03 = Native MAP

PC : Program number

Drum set list dump

Drum set list dump request (receive only) [Pro]

This command requests a bulk dump transmission of a list of Preset Drum Sets in internal memory, and uses "Data Request 1 (RQ1)" format. The Size specifies the desired data contents.

Address:

0C 00 02

Size:

00 00 00

: ALL

 

00 00 01

: SC-55 MAP

 

00 00 02

: SC-88 MAP

 

00 00 03

: Native MAP

Drum set list dump (transmit only) [Pro]

When a Drum Set List Dump Request is received, the Drum Set names of the specified MAP will be transmitted successively in the format given below, where 16 bytes are used for each sound. The Address of the transmitted data will be 0C 00 02 for each packet.

DUMP FORMAT:

 

0

1 2

3

 

4 5 6 7 8 9 A B C D E F

 

 

00

MAP

PC

00

 

DRUM TONE NAME(ASCII 12 Characters)

 

 

 

 

 

 

 

 

 

 

MAP : MAP number

01 = SC-55 MAP, 02 = SC-88 MAP, 03 = Native MAP

PC : Program number

 

 

Drum instrument list dump

Drum instrument list dump request (receive only) [Pro]

This command requests a bulk dump transmission of the Instrument list of an internal Preset Drum Sets, and uses "Data Request 1 (RQ1)" format. The Size specifies the desired data contents.

Address:

0C 00 03

Size:

00 mm pp mm = MAP# 01 - 03 ( 01 = SC-55 MAP, 02 = SC-88 MAP,

 

03 = Native MAP)

pp= Drum set# 00 - 7F (same as PC#)

Drum instrument list dump (transmit only) [Pro]

When a Drum Instrument List Dump Request is received, the Drum Instrument names of the specified Drum Set will be transmitted in the following format where 16 bytes are used for each Drum Instrument name. The address of the transmitted data will be 0C 00 03 for each packet.

DUMP FORMAT:

 

0

1 2

3

 

4 5 6 7 8 9 A B C D E F

 

 

00

MAP

PC

KEY

 

DRUM TONE NAME(ASCII 12 Characters)

 

 

 

 

 

 

 

 

 

 

MAP : MAP number

01 = SC-55 MAP, 02 = SC-88 MAP, 03 = Native MAP

PC : Program number

 

 

KEY : Note number

 

 

Insertion effect list dump

Insertion effect list dump request (receive only) [Pro]

This command requests a bulk dump transmission of the Insertion effect list of an internal memory, and uses "Data Request 1 (RQ1)" format. The Size specifies the desired data contents.

Address:

0C 00 04

Size:

00 00 00 : ALL

Insertion effect list dump (transmit only) [Pro]

When a Insertion Effect List Dump Request is received, the specified Insertion Effect names will be transmitted in the following format where 20 bytes are used for each Effect name. The address of the transmitted data will be 0C 00 04 for each packet.

DUMP FORMAT :

0

1

2

3

4

5

6

7

8

9 A B C D E F 10 11 12 13

 

MSB

LSB

00

00

 

EFFECT NAME(ASCII 16 Characters)

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

MSB : Category

LSB : Type

Preset patch list dump

Preset patch list dump request (receive only) [Pro]

This command requests a bulk dump transmission of the Preset patch list of an internal memory, and uses "Data Request 1 (RQ1)" format. The Size specifies the desired data contents.

Address:

0C 00 05

Size:

00 00 00 : ALL

Preset patch list dump (transmit only) [Pro]

When a Preset Patch List Dump Request is received, the specified Preset patch names will be transmitted in the following format where 20 bytes are used for each Patch name. The address of the transmitted data will be 0C 00 05 for each packet.

DUMP FORMAT :

0

1

2

3

4 5

6 7 8 9 A B C D E F

10 11 12 13

 

 

00

00

PC

00

PATCH NAME(ASCII 16 Characters)

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

PC : Program number

206

Chapter 8. Appendix